... |
... |
@@ -49,7
+49,7 @@ |
49 |
49 |
Durch das Suffix wird es möglich mehrere Authentifizierungen und Formularelement-Vorbelegungen innerhalb eines Formulars zu realisieren. |
50 |
50 |
: Als Suffix sind Buchstaben, Zahlen und der Unterstrich erlaubt. |
51 |
51 |
: __Beispiel:__ |
52 |
|
-Wenn als Suffix „_1“ definiert wurde, muss das Formularfeld für die Adresse mit dem Namen „tfAntragstellerAdresse_1“ benannt werden, damit eine Vorbelegung erfolgreich stattfinden kann. |
|
52 |
+Wenn als Suffix "**_1**" definiert wurde, muss das Formularfeld für die Adresse mit dem Namen "tfAntragstellerAdresse**_1**" benannt werden, damit eine Vorbelegung erfolgreich stattfinden kann. |
53 |
53 |
; gefordertes Authentifizierungsverfahren |
54 |
54 |
: Hier kann das dem Nutzer zur Verfügung stehende Authentifizierungsverfahren eingeschränkt werden. |
55 |
55 |
: Es gibt folgende Auswahlmöglichkeiten: |
... |
... |
@@ -65,7
+65,7 @@ |
65 |
65 |
Formularvorlage //AKDB Basisdienste// |
66 |
66 |
{{/figure}} |
67 |
67 |
|
68 |
|
-Um die Daten aus dem Bürgerservice-Portal im Formular anzuzeigen, existieren zwei Vorlagen //Bürgerkonto personenbezogene Daten// und //Bürgerkonto organisationsbezogene Daten//. Die Felder innerhalb dieser Vorlagen sind so konfiguriert, dass sie eine automatische Zuordnung und damit die Anzeige der zurückgelieferten Daten ermöglichen. Die jeweilige Vorlage ist je nach der eingestellten [[Art der Rückgabedaten>>doc:||anchor="Art_Rueckgabedaten"]] am //AKDB Bürgerkonto//-Button zu wählen. |
|
68 |
+Um die Daten aus dem Bürgerservice-Portal im Formular anzuzeigen, existieren zwei Vorlagen //Bürgerkonto personenbezogene Daten// und //Bürgerkonto organisationsbezogene Daten//. Die Felder innerhalb dieser Vorlagen sind so konfiguriert, dass sie eine automatische Zuordnung und damit die Anzeige der zurückgelieferten Daten ermöglichen. Die jeweilige Vorlage ist je nach der eingestellten [[Art der Rückgabedaten>>doc:||anchor="Art_Rueckgabedaten"]] am //AKDB Bürgerkonto//-Button zu wählen. Bei Nutzung der eingangs erwähnten Formular-Templates, sind beide Designer-Vorlagen bereits eingebunden und werden nach anzuzeigender Datenart ein- oder ausgeblendet. |
69 |
69 |
|
70 |
70 |
Die vom Bürgerservice-Portal zurückgelieferten Daten können mittels JavaScript auch anderweitig weiterverarbeitet werden. Dafür werden sie in Form einer JSON-Struktur im Zielformular zur Verfügung gestellt. Die JSON Struktur kann über folgende JavaScript-Variable ausgelesen werden: |
71 |
71 |
|
... |
... |
@@ -77,7
+77,8 @@ |
77 |
77 |
Die nachfolgenden Tabelle listet alle Formularfeld-Namen auf, die in einem Formular genutzt werden können, um die Daten vom Bürgerservice-Portal in Formular-Elementen anzuzeigen. Einige Informationen sind über verschiedene Parameter-Namen abrufbar (einen englisch-sprachigen und einen deutsch-sprachigen Namen), in solchen Fällen können beide Benamungen gleichwertig genutzt werden. |
78 |
78 |
|
79 |
79 |
{{info}} |
80 |
|
-Parameter, welche nur bei einer **p**ersonen**b**ezogenen **A**nmeldung vorhanden sind, sind mit **(PBA)** und die die nur bei einer **o**rganisations**b**ezogenen **A**nmeldung vorhanden sind, mit **(OBA)** gekennzeichnet. Ist keine extra Kennzeichnung vorhanden, so ist der Parameter in beiden Bereichen vorhanden. |
|
80 |
+Parameter, welche nur bei einer **p**ersonen**b**ezogenen **A**nmeldung vorhanden sind, sind mit **(PBA)** und die die nur bei einer **o**rganisations**b**ezogenen **A**nmeldung vorhanden sind, mit **(OBA)** gekennzeichnet. |
|
81 |
+Ist keine extra Kennzeichnung vorhanden, so ist der Parameter in beiden Bereichen vorhanden. |
81 |
81 |
{{/info}} |
82 |
82 |
|
83 |
83 |
{{table dataTypeAlpha="0" preSort="0-asc"}} |
... |
... |
@@ -113,7
+113,7 @@ |
113 |
113 |
|((( |
114 |
114 |
ZipCode (PBA) |
115 |
115 |
tfAntragstellerPLZ (PBA) |
116 |
|
-)))|PLZ |
|
117 |
+)))|Postleitzahl |
117 |
117 |
|((( |
118 |
118 |
Address (PBA) |
119 |
119 |
tfAntragstellerAdresse (PBA) |
... |
... |
@@ -161,17
+161,17 @@ |
161 |
161 |
|tfOrgRegisterNummer (OBA)|Registernummer |
162 |
162 |
|TrustLevel|((( |
163 |
163 |
Vertrauensniveau, gibt Auskunft über gewählte Authentifizierungsmethode: |
164 |
|
-**STORK-QAA-Level-1**: Authentifizierung mittels Benutzername / Passwort |
165 |
|
-**STORK-QAA-Level-3:** Authentifizierung mittels Authega Zertifikat |
166 |
|
-**STORK-QAA-Level-4**: Authentifizierung mittels nPA |
|
165 |
+* **STORK-QAA-Level-1**: Authentifizierung mittels Benutzername / Passwort |
|
166 |
+* **STORK-QAA-Level-3:** Authentifizierung mittels Authega Zertifikat |
|
167 |
+* **STORK-QAA-Level-4**: Authentifizierung mittels nPA |
167 |
167 |
))) |
168 |
|
-|NPA_Address (PBA)|Adresse, wie sie auf dem NPA vermerkt ist (Alles in Großbuchstaben) |
169 |
|
-|NPA_City (PBA)|Ort, wie er auf dem NPA vermerkt ist (Alles in Großbuchstaben) |
170 |
|
-|NPA_FirstName|Vorname, wie er auf dem NPA vermerkt ist (Alles in Großbuchstaben) |
171 |
|
-|NPA_LastName|Nachname, wie er auf dem NPA vermerkt ist (Alles in Großbuchstaben) |
172 |
|
-|NPA_PersonalTitle|Akademischer Titel, wie er auf dem NPA vermerkt ist (Alles in Großbuchstaben) |
173 |
|
-|IsIndividualPerson|Liefert den Wert **true** wenn es sich bei den Daten aus dem Bürgerkonto um personenbezogene Daten handelt, sonst **false**. |
174 |
|
-|IsOrganization|Liefert den Wert **true** wenn es sich bei den Daten aus dem Bürgerkonto um organisationsbezogene Daten handelt, sonst **false**. |
|
169 |
+|NPA_Address (PBA)|Adresse, wie sie auf dem NPA vermerkt ist (alles in Großbuchstaben) |
|
170 |
+|NPA_City (PBA)|Ort, wie er auf dem NPA vermerkt ist (alles in Großbuchstaben) |
|
171 |
+|NPA_FirstName|Vorname, wie er auf dem NPA vermerkt ist (alles in Großbuchstaben) |
|
172 |
+|NPA_LastName|Nachname, wie er auf dem NPA vermerkt ist (alles in Großbuchstaben) |
|
173 |
+|NPA_PersonalTitle|Akademischer Titel, wie er auf dem NPA vermerkt ist (alles in Großbuchstaben) |
|
174 |
+|IsIndividualPerson|Liefert den Wert **true**, wenn es sich bei den Daten aus dem Bürgerkonto um personenbezogene Daten handelt, sonst **false**. |
|
175 |
+|IsOrganization|Liefert den Wert **true**, wenn es sich bei den Daten aus dem Bürgerkonto um organisationsbezogene Daten handelt, sonst **false**. |
175 |
175 |
{{/table}} |
176 |
176 |
|
177 |
177 |
{{info}} |
... |
... |
@@ -221,9
+221,10 @@ |
221 |
221 |
; Absender-Link |
222 |
222 |
: Falls sich die Angabe im Feld //Mandant// auf einen Mandanten bezieht, der nicht im Bürgerservice-Portal registriert ist, kann über den //Absender-Link// ein Link mitgegeben werden, mit dem der Mandant bei der Anzeige im AKDB Postkorb verlinkt wird. |
223 |
223 |
; Postkorb ID aus den Vorgangsdaten ermitteln? |
224 |
|
-: Diese Angabe dient der Bestimmung zur Ermittlung der Postkorb-ID. Über die Postkorb-ID wird das genaue Ziel für den Nachrichtenversand bestimmt, also der Nachrichten-Empfänger. |
225 |
|
-Bei einem AKDB Bürgerkonto-Login wird die Postkorb-ID immer mit übermittelt und standardmäßig am FORMCYCLE Vorgang hinterlegt. |
226 |
|
-Standardmäßig wird versucht die notwendige Postkorb-ID aus den am FORMCYCLE Vorgang hinterlegten Daten zu ermitteln. Wenn es mehrere konfigurierte Anmeldungen innerhalb eines Formulars gibt, so ist die Auswahl über den Bürgerdaten Parameter-Suffix einzugrenzen. |
|
225 |
+: Diese Angabe dient zur Bestimmung der Postkorb-ID. Über die Postkorb-ID wird das genaue Ziel für den Nachrichtenversand bestimmt, also der Nachrichten-Empfänger. |
|
226 |
+Bei einem AKDB Bürgerkonto-Login wird die Postkorb-ID immer mit übermittelt und standardmäßig am Formulareingang hinterlegt. |
|
227 |
+Wenn an dieser Stelle die standardmäßige Einstellung verwendet wird, so wird versucht die Postkorb-ID immer aus den am Formulareingang hinterlegten Daten zu ermitteln. |
|
228 |
+Für den Fall, dass es mehrere konfigurierte Anmeldungen innerhalb eines Formulars gibt, kann hier die Auswahl über den Bürgerdaten Parameter-Suffix eingegrenzt werden. |
227 |
227 |
Darüber hinaus ist es möglich die Postkorb-ID fest oder über einen Platzhalter (**[%$POSTKORB_ID%]**) zu definieren. |
228 |
228 |
|
229 |
229 |
|
... |
... |
@@ -265,7
+265,8 @@ |
265 |
265 |
Konfiguration einer Bedingung für Ausführung der Aktion //AKDB~:Postkorbnachricht senden// |
266 |
266 |
{{/figure}} |
267 |
267 |
|
268 |
|
-Um eine Nachricht an den Postkorb-Schnittstelle der AKDB zu übermitteln ist eine so genannte "//Postkorb-ID//" notwendig. Ähnlich einer E-Mail-Adresse stellt sie ein Merkmal dar, womit das Postfach eines Nutzers eindeutig im System der AKDB identifiziert werden kann. Die Ermittlung der //Postkorb-ID// eines Benutzers erfolgt dabei automatisch beim Login am Bürgerservice-Portal der AKDB, wodurch dieser Identifikator dann im weiteren Formularprozess zur Verfügung steht. Dies bedeutet aber auch, dass wenn in einem Formularprozess kein zwingender Bürgerkonto-Login erfolgt, die Postkorb-ID **nicht** in der Statusverarbeitung vorhanden ist. |
|
270 |
+Um eine Nachricht an den Postkorb-Schnittstelle der AKDB zu übermitteln ist eine so genannte "//Postkorb-ID//" notwendig. Ähnlich einer E-Mail-Adresse stellt sie ein Merkmal dar, womit das Postfach eines Nutzers eindeutig im System der AKDB identifiziert werden kann. Die Ermittlung der //Postkorb-ID// eines Benutzers erfolgt dabei automatisch beim Login am Bürgerservice-Portal der AKDB, wodurch dieser Identifikator dann im weiteren Formularprozess zur Verfügung steht. |
|
271 |
+Dies bedeutet aber auch, dass wenn in einem Formularprozess kein zwingender Bürgerkonto-Login erfolgt, die Postkorb-ID **nicht** in der Statusverarbeitung vorhanden ist. |
269 |
269 |
Damit die Statusverarbeitung bei Verwendung der Aktion **AKDB:Postkorbnachricht senden** nicht in einem Fehler resultiert, ist deshalb die Konfiguration einer entsprechenden Ausführungs-Bedingung sinnvoll. |
270 |
270 |
|
271 |
271 |
Das nachfolgende Quellcode-Beispiel zeigt das Abprüfen der Postkorb-ID durch einen regulären Ausdruck. Die aktuelle Postkorb-ID wird dabei mittels eines System-Platzhalters im Prüfausdruck zur Verfügung gestellt. |